    posted a message on Diablo 1 or Diablo 2
    The diablo 1 story line was much better. The story was spread out through tombs that ha to be read, and everything tied in together.

    In diablo 2, you had to take a portal back to Tristram, rescue cain, then take portal back. In all, there was too much moving around, too many portals here and there.

    D1 did an awesome job of tying the whole game in with the story line. You did not have to go here or there, you just played the game and got the story along the way.

    The story line of D2 was kinda lame anyway.

    posted a message on is diablo 3 going to be in acts?
    I hope not, I never did like the "Acts" change from Diablo 1 to D2.

    The game play style of D1 was much better where you had a slow change from a church to caves, to lava fields to diablos lair. D2 jumped around too much, it would have been much better if, instead of a portal, you were able to walk from one region to another and saw the area change from one to another. This would have added a whole deminsion to the game. But instead of that, the developers took the easy way out and add a portal.

    Bah - no acts, just one big world with a slow transition from one part to another.
